Blog admin - engedélyezheti és használhatja a visszaváltási adatbázist

A FLASHBACK DATABASE lehetővé teszi, hogy visszaállítsa az adatbázisban lévő összes változtatást az adatbázis visszanyerése nélkül. Nagyon hasznos például, ha vissza kell állítania az alkalmazásfrissítést az adatbázisban. Visszaállíthatja az adatbázist a létrehozott visszaállítási pontra, valamint egy adott időbélyegzőre és SCN pontra. Azonban ez nem „szabad” a teljesítményét a technológia, ha a Flashback adatbázis lehetőséget az adatbázisban rögzítik kezdve az új folyóiratok (flashback naplók) a FRA.

A FLASHBACK DATABASE használatához a következőkre van szüksége:

  • SYSDBA jogok;
  • FLASHBACK engedélyezése;
  • Engedélyezze az ARCHIVELOG módot;
  • A FLASHBACK használatakor az adatbázisnak mount módban kell lennie;
  • Minden FLASHBACK táblaterületet engedélyezni kell;
  • Db_recovery_file_dest és db_recovery_file_dest_size paraméterek;
  • A db_flashback_retention_target paraméter;

Ellenőrizzük, hogy engedélyezzük-e a visszaemlékezést, ha nem, majd engedélyezzük.

A db_flashback_retention_target paraméter azt jelzi, hogy mennyi ideig lehet visszaforgatni az adatbázist. A perc percben van beállítva, és az alapértelmezett beállítás 1 nap.

A db_recovery_file_dest és a db_recovery_file_dest_size paraméterek felelősek az FRA elérési útjához és annak méretéhez.

Ismerd fel az aktuális SCN-t, hogy a jövőben visszafordulhass hozzá. Az adatbázis visszaállításához fel kell venni a mount módot.

Az adatbázis visszatért az asztal létrehozása előtti időpontig. Az adatbázis visszaállítása az állapotba a visszaállítás előtt.

Lássuk, hogyan tud visszafordítani egy adott időpontra:

Az adatbázist visszavettük a pontra, mielőtt a rekordot behelyeztük az asztalra. Az adatbázis visszaállítása az állapotba a visszaállítás előtt.

Helyreállítási pontok létrehozása: normál és garantált. Garantált pont létrehozásakor ügyelni kell arra, hogy elegendő hely legyen az FRA-ban a szükséges tárolási időnek megfelelően.

A visszaváltási naplók bizonyos táblaterületeken letilthatók. Ebben az esetben a visszaállítás előtt ezeket a táblaterület fájlokat az offline módba kell átszámítani a következő paranccsal: az adatbázis adatfájl megváltoztatása "/tmp/tsttbs.dbf" offline állapotban;

Korlátozások Flashback adatbázis:

  • A Flashback adatbázis csak a DBMS által készített adatfájl módosításait vonhatja vissza.
  • A zsugorodási művelet visszavonásához a Flashback Database nem használható.
  • Nem törölheti a törölt fájlt. Ebben az esetben a törölt fájl visszaáll a biztonsági másolatból, és a többi fájl visszavonásra kerül visszaváltásra.
  • Ha a vezérlőfájlt visszaállítja a biztonsági mentésből vagy újból létrehozza, a flashback naplóin lévő összes információ elvész.
  • Ha NOLOGGING műveleteket használ, akkor a visszaállítás után hibás blokkok lehetnek, amelyeken NOLOGGING műveletek történtek. A NOLOGGING módban minden egyes művelet után tanácsos biztonsági másolatot készíteni.

Ingatlan leírása
Paramétertípus Integer
Alapértelmezett érték 1440 (perc)
Módosítható ALTER RENDSZER
0 - 232 - 1 értéktartomány (max. Érték 32 bites értékkel)
Basic No
helyes)

Természetesen perceken belül.
Köszönjük észrevételeit.
A cikk javítva.